The Opportunity
As an Enterprise Asset Management (EAM) professional, you'll focus on enhancing and digitally enabling our clients' work and asset management capabilities. You'll collaborate with high-performing teams to drive growth and deliver exceptional client service, ensuring better working assets.
Your Role
As an Enterprise Asset Management (EAM) Senior, you will support EY clients in enhancing and digitally enabling their work and asset management capabilities. You will work as part of high‑performing engagement teams, contributing deep functional and technical expertise to deliver quality outcomes across IBM Maximo, Maximo Application Suite (MAS), and related Field Service Management (FSM) solutions.
Your Key Responsibilities:
- Deliver MAS and related FSM consulting services to EAM clients, contributing hands‑on expertise across implementation, enhancement, and upgrade activities.
- Execute assigned functional and technical tasks including requirements gathering and documentation, system configuration and setup, testing, and support for deployment and stabilization activities with increasing independence, escalating risks and issues appropriately.
- Support engagement plans by completing deliverables accurately, on time, and in alignment with defined scope and standards.
- Develop and maintain a strong understanding of Maximo / MAS application functionality and capabilities, EAM / FSM business processes, and how Maximo/MAS can enable those processes to improve performance and outcomes.
- Interact with client users to gather information, validate requirements, and provide insight into how MAS / FSM native functional meets those requirements versus customization options.
- Collaborate effectively with EY teammates across functional and technical roles.
- Communicate progress, risks, and issues clearly to engagement leadership.
- Support Managers and Senior Managers by contributing insights, analysis, and recommendations.
- Share knowledge and best practices with peers and junior team members.
- Contribute to internal knowledge assets and help strengthen EY's EAM and FSM capabilities.

- Bachelor's degree in Business, Information Technology, Engineering, or a related field.
- 3-5 years of relevant experience, including supporting Maximo and/or MAS solution implementations, enhancements, or upgrades with FSM solutions.
- Working knowledge of FSM processes including work scheduling, dispatch, and execution processes and related FSM technologies.
- Working knowledge of relational databases, reporting, and related technologies.
- Understanding of software development and application lifecycle concepts.
- Willingness to travel up to 60+%; valid driver's license and US passport required.
- Experience in asset‑intensive industries (e.g., utilities, manufacturing, transportation).
- Familiarity with asset lifecycle processes (planning, execution, as‑built).
- Experience with other EAM platforms (SAP EAM, Infor, Oracle).
- Interest in developing deeper specialization in EAM, MAS, or FSM.
- EAM Configuration tools experience is desired.

- We offer a comprehensive compensation and benefits package where you'll be rewarded based on your performance and recognized for the value you bring to the business. The base salary range for this job in all geographic locations in the US is $102,500 to $187,900. The base salary range for New York City Metro Area, Washington State and California (excluding Sacramento) is $122,900 to $213,400. Individual salaries within those ranges are determined through a wide variety of factors including but not limited to education, experience, knowledge, skills and geography. In addition, our Total Rewards package includes medical and dental coverage, pension and 401(k) plans, and a wide range of paid time off options.
- Join us in our team-led and leader-enabled hybrid model. Our expectation is for most people in external, client serving roles to work together in person 40-60% of the time over the course of an engagement, project or year.
- Under our flexible vacation policy, you'll decide how much vacation time you need based on your own personal circumstances. You'll also be granted time off for designated EY Paid Holidays, Winter/Summer breaks, Personal/Family Care, and other leaves of absence when needed to support your physical, financial, and emotional well-being.
